Common Questions from Seymour Pet Parents

How far is your facility from Seymour?

We're located at 7337 Tomotley Road in Maryville, just 20 minutes from downtown Seymour via Chapman Highway. It's an easy drive with no mountain roads.

Do you offer pet taxi service from Seymour?

Yes! We provide round-trip pet transportation from Seymour for just $20. We'll pick up your pup and return them home safely.

What areas near Seymour do you serve?

We serve all of Seymour, Sevierville, Pigeon Forge, and surrounding communities. Many vacation rental guests use our services too!

Do you board dogs during Smoky Mountain tourist season?

Absolutely! We're experienced with vacation boarding and understand the needs of families visiting the Smokies. Book early during peak season!
